How Do Most Couples Format Lavender Invitations?

When couples are deciding what their invitations should look like, what layout do they usually go for, and how much decoration is too much? Around seven out of ten will pick a vertical (portrait) style, since it focuses attention on key details and shows off the chosen color. A horizontal (landscape) format only attracts about one in ten, so you can see it’s less common. Most couples are seeking simplicity: the majority choose invitations that show only text, while just a few add in a single photo, and almost nobody includes more. While some select frames or even a wreath design, clean styles without much extra continue to prevail.

When Should You Order Lavender Invitations?

Planning ahead matters, and if you want a smooth process, you’ll need to order 4-5 months before your wedding date. This timing allows you to adjust details, view proofs, and get everything addressed before mailing the invitations 6-8 weeks ahead. Following this approach ensures your guests get plenty of time to plan, but not so much that the moment is lost.
